The World's Worst Traffic Engineers

For the most densely-populated state in the nation, New Jersey has some of the world's worst traffic engineering. New Jersey is responsible for one of the ugliest traffic inventions: the "New Jersey divider," that concrete barrier that now adorns the middle of every major highway and an increasing number of "dualized" local roads. Too low to prevent the glare of oncoming headlights, of course. Any color you like, as long as it's gray. And naturally it's designed to divide towns, prevent left turns, and demolish both you and your vehicle if you run into one.

Apart from the abysmal design of the highways, there's the total aversion to pedestrians and cyclists in the planning departments of almost every city and town. Not incidentally, NJ has the highest per capita record of pedestrian fatalities in the nation.

The Country's Worst Environmental Disasters
New Jersey has the country's largest number of Superfund sites, and also has some of the nation's most pointless environmental legislation as well.

Most Overplayed Historical Event
The dubious conviction of Bruno Hauptmann for the kidnapping of the Lindbergh baby is re-enacted each year at the Flemington courthouse.

Best Roadside Pancake House


T.J.'s, on Route 202 in Flemington had the imagination to go through the archives of the Hunterdon County Democrat and embed 19th-century clippings and photos in the plastic tabletops, giving a greater insight into the history of this area than much of the commercial restoration in the town of Flemington proper.
